Macros

#define IRQ_TYPE_NONE   0
 No trigger.
#define IRQ_TYPE_EDGE_RISING   1
 Rising edge trigger.
#define IRQ_TYPE_EDGE_FALLING   2
 Falling edge trigger.
#define IRQ_TYPE_EDGE_BOTH   (IRQ_TYPE_EDGE_FALLING | IRQ_TYPE_EDGE_RISING)
 Both edges.
#define IRQ_TYPE_LEVEL_HIGH   4
 Active-high level trigger.
#define IRQ_TYPE_LEVEL_LOW   8
 Active-low level trigger.

Detailed Description

Devicetree macros for the ITE IT8XXX2 interrupt controller (INTC).

Macros for encoding interrupt cells for the ite,it8xxx2-intc compatible interrupt controller. An interrupt is described by two cells: the interrupt number and the trigger type (one of the IRQ_TYPE_* flags below).

Interrupt numbers follow the pattern IT8XXX2_IRQ_<source>, where <source> is the IT8XXX2 interrupt source name (for example IT8XXX2_IRQ_TIMER1 or IT8XXX2_IRQ_SMB_A).

&timer {
interrupts = <IT8XXX2_IRQ_TIMER1 IRQ_TYPE_EDGE_RISING>;
};
